At first, the ratio of the number of boys to the number of girls at a school playground was 2 : 5. When 48 girls and some boys entered the playground, the number of girls increased by 12% and the total number of children at the playground increased by 20%.
  1. How many boys were there at first?
  2. What percentage of the children at the playground were boys in the end? Express your answer as a mixed number.

The usual price of a notebook sold at Shop A and B is $20. During a sale, a discount of 20% is given to every notebook sold at Shop A. At Shop B, a discount of 50% is given to the 3rd notebook for every 3 notebooks sold. How much cheaper would it be if Lily buys 8 notebooks from Shop A instead of Shop B?
